Output 3fc75c052e1c78a478cf2af0c9c531a03e1ba907e00d18b640c2da75fa11de1b:0

value
6636248
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f760338e66aeaa67e4ccd707c2f18a442220a6ff1bc8f203c20f9c913968c52
address
bc1pdamqxw8xdt42vljve4c8ctcc53pzyzn07x7g7gpuyruujyuk33fqk969s5
transaction
3fc75c052e1c78a478cf2af0c9c531a03e1ba907e00d18b640c2da75fa11de1b
spent
true